Quarterly Round-Up

Operation Round-Up trustees met in April to review quarterly grant applications. Five applicants received funding; totaling $7,237.20. To date Operation Round-Up has provided $85,450 in funding thanks to members who choose to have their monthly bill rounded up.

St. Paul School in Macomb received $1,237.20 for flexible seating in one of their third-grade classrooms. Mrs. Kayleigh Gray applied for the grant so that she can switch out the traditional seating in her classroom with flexible seating options that will allow her students to release their energy and improve productivity while learning.

West Prairie High School was approved to receive $1,500 towards the cost of purchasing a RedCat Audio System. The school is currently utilizing borrowed equipment, which provides an accommodation for hearing loss students, those with att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der and the general population. These devices will enhance the learning environment for all students.

West Central Illinois Arts Center was granted $1,500 for their afterschool Youth Arts Program. The WCIAC will offer youth programming, which will fill a void left by the dissolution of the WIU Community Youth Art Program.

Warren County Agricultural Fair Association will benefit from a $1,500 grant towards the purchase of new pens for their livestock housing barns. The pens that are currently being used have been there for 50-plus years. This upgrade will benefit the many groups that utilize the facility, including 4-H groups of Warren County, the Warren County Beef Festival, Section 4 FFA Fair, and WIU Hoof ‘N’ Horn Show.

Colchester Area Gathering Place will receive $1,500 for their summer food program. This group of volunteers gathers resources to provide sacks of food on weekends and during the summer for children residing in rural areas of McDonough county. Last year the group spent close to $10,000 providing food sacks once a week for 249 children.
